Customers Tracked
138,844
Last Updated
- 4/17/2025 9:56:24 PM GMT
Electric Providers
Electric Providers for Cleveland
Provider
Customers Tracked
Customers Out
Last Updated
|
16 0 3/13/2025 11:52:56 PM GMT |
108,051 30 4/17/2025 9:56:24 PM GMT |
30,777 0 4/17/2025 9:56:21 PM GMT |